you can use MC2XML or XMLTV to download your Schedules Direct data into an XMLTV file and just re-map your channels to that file; no need to downgrade. then you just need an updateepg.bat in the scripts directory which NRecord will run each night before reading the XMLTV file. For MC2XML it would simply be:
Code:
cd \path-to-mc2xml
mc2xml
(the .dat file created when you first run MC2XML will take care of the parameters and login info)

I had what I think is the same problem you've been struggling with. I'm running Windows 7 Pro SP1. If I did:

Settings
Channels
Click on a channel using Schedules Direct to select it
Click on Details button

I got an error message and a red X in the Lineup box.

I finally got that to go away by a combination of suggestions from this thread.

I updated NShared.dll
MD5: 66e771addb7adf961d377fab22045bec

I updated NextPVR.exe
MD5: aac7acb32baa0fd30d0502eb6fe291e1

Those didn't get rid of the problem. Finally, I went back to an Aero theme.

Right-click on a blank spot on the Windows desktop
Personalize
Select one of the Aero themes

That got rid of the red X, so I can continue to work on resolving some other issues I'm having due to Time Warner Cable (Los Angeles) having changed over to a completely encrypted digital system that requires use of a DTA (I have the lowest level of TWC service), so all my channels now come out of the DTA as analog channel 3 signals.
